The R500 is a Regional Route in South Africa. It begins just west of Magaliesburg and runs roughly north-south. Although it starts in North West it soon enters Gauteng province. First it crosses the N14, before it meets the western end of the R41. From there, it runs through Carletonville, where it intersects with the R501. Continuing south, it crosses the N12 and runs through Fochville. The road then intersects the R54 passing back into the North West province before crossing the Vaal river and reaches its southern terminus at the R59 in the town of Parys in the Free State.
